Japan's podcast ad revenue is projected to reach approximately USD 850 million in 2026, reflecting strong advertiser interest in digital audio formats. The growth is driven by increased smartphone penetration and a shift towards personalized content consumption. The rising number of listeners, estimated at 70 million, indicates a significant market opportunity for content creators and advertisers alike.
Listening habits in Japan show an average of 8.5 hours per month per person, highlighting a deep engagement with audio content. Digital audio's market share continues to rise, now accounting for 35% of total media consumption. Popular genres like technology, business, and entertainment are leading the growth, catering to Japan's tech-savvy and culturally diverse audience.
